Injecting gas into the blood vessels can cause an air embolism. The way to remove air from the syringe to avoid embolism is to turn the syringe upside down, tap it gently, and then squeeze out a little liquid before injecting it into the bloodstream.
Injection and Infusion Equipment can be made of plastic or glass and usually have a scale indicating the volume of liquid in the syringe. Glass syringes can be sterilized with autoclaves, but because plastic syringes are cheaper to dispose of, modern medical syringes are mostly made of plastic, which further reduces the risk of blood-borne diseases. Reuse of needles and syringes is associated with the spread of diseases, particularly HIV and hepatitis, among intravenous drug users.

Infusion Pump: An infusion pump is usually a mechanical or electronic control device that acts on an infusion catheter to control the rate of infusion. It is often used in situations where the volume and dosage of fluids need to be strictly controlled, such as during the use of pressors, antiarrhythmic drugs, intravenous fluids in infants, or intravenous anesthesia. Intravenous Injection Accessories: Iv is a medical treatment in which a liquid substance, such as blood, liquid medicine, or nutrient solution, is injected directly into a vein. Intravenous injection can be divided into transient and continuous, transient intravenous injection with a syringe directly injected into the vein, that is, the common "injection"; Continuous intravenous injection is carried out by intravenous drip, commonly known as "drip".

Silicone Urine Collector Bag Adults Urinal with Urine Catheter Bags for Older Men Woman Elderly Toilet Pee: Is a tube inserted from the urethra into the bladder to drain urine. It is a pipe made of natural rubber, silicone rubber or polyvinyl chloride (PVC), which can be inserted into the bladder through the urethra to drain urine out. After the catheter is inserted into the bladder, there is an air bag near the head of the catheter to fix the catheter in the bladder, and it is not easy to slip out. And the drainage tube is connected to the urine bag to collect urine.
